Man City 1 Brentford 2: Ivan Toney STUNS Prem champions with 97TH MINUTE winner in World Cup message to Southgate

Published on November 12, 2022 at 02:41 PM

MANCHESTER CITY were denied the chance to go top of the Premier League table for Christmas by an in-form Brentford side.

Ivan Toney – who was denied a place in England’s World Cup squad earlier this week – scored a brace to seal all three points for the Bees.

The striker put his side ahead just 16 minutes into the game, much to the shock of the home fans.

Foden equalised just before half time, but Toney silenced his doubters once again with a 97th minute winner.
